Penn State Abington ranked #-1 and Reformed ranked #-1 in national university ranking. The following statements compare Pennsylvania State University-Penn State Abington and Reformed University with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
- Penn State Abington's tuition ($25,388) is more expensive than Reformed ($5,360).
- Reformed's acceptance rate (73.42%) is lower than Penn State Abington (92.03%).
- Reformed has higher yield (79.31%) than Penn State Abington (15.02%).
- Both schools have same SAT scores of 1,180.
- Penn State Abington's students to faculty ratio (14 to 1) is lower than Reformed (15 to 1).
- Penn State Abington (3,095 students) is larger than Reformed (331 students) with more enrolled students.
- Penn State Abington ($9,585) has higher amount of financial aid than Reformed ($2,597).
- Reformed's graduation rate (50%) is higher than Penn State Abington (22%).
